Research Analyst salary in United Kingdom

Average Yearly Salary of Research Analyst in United Kingdom is approximately 43,846 GBP (51,608 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. What does Research Analyst do?

occupation personasA research analyst is a professional who gathers and analyzes data to provide insights and recommendations for decision-making purposes. They work in various industries, including finance, market research, consulting, and healthcare. Research analysts are responsible for conducting extensive research, collecting relevant data from multiple sources, and using statistical techniques to analyze and interpret the information. They create reports and presentations summarizing their findings and present them to key stakeholders. Additionally, research analysts may also be involved in forecasting trends, monitoring industry developments, and identifying potential opportunities or risks. Str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and the ability to effectively communicate complex information are crucial for success in this role.

Salary increase per years of experience

Based on data available the salary increase per years of experience is as following

    0 years (beginner) equals base salary
    1 to 5 years of experience yields up arrow+12% salary increase
    6 to 10 years of experience yields up arrow+25% salary increase
    11 to 15 years of experience yields up arrow+16% salary increase
    16 to 25 years of experience yields up arrow+9% salary increase
    more than 25 years of experience yields up arrow+10% salary increase
NOTE: Details based on limited set of data. Percentages may vary. The salary increase over years of experience can vary widely based on factors such as job industry, job role, location, company size, and individual performance.
